Subject: perf: Fix double-free of the AUX buffer

From: Ben Hutchings <[email protected]>

commit ee9397a6fb9bc4e52677f5e33eed4abee0f515e6 upstream.

If rb->aux_refcount is decremented to zero before rb->refcount,
__rb_free_aux() may be called twice resulting in a double free of
rb->aux_pages.  Fix this by adding a check to __rb_free_aux().
